Find Inner Peace Through Movement: Tai Chi Practice
In today's fast-paced world, finding inner peace is essential for our well-being. One way to achieve this is through the practice of Tai Chi, an ancient Chinese martial art known for its gentle movements, meditation, and health benefits. Tai Chi, often referred to as "meditation in motion," can help reduce stress, improve balance, and increase overall mindfulness.
The Benefits of Tai Chi Practice
1. Stress Reduction: The slow, flowing movements of Tai Chi can help calm the mind, reduce anxiety, and promote relaxation.
2. Improved Balance: Tai Chi exercises focus on weight shifting and coordination, which can enhance stability and reduce the risk of falls, especially in older adults.
3. Increased Mindfulness: By focusing on the present moment and the fluidity of movements, Tai Chi can help practitioners develop a greater sense of awareness and concentration.
Getting Started with Tai Chi
If you're interested in starting a Tai Chi practice, consider taking a class with a qualified instructor to learn the proper techniques and forms. You can also find online resources and videos to practice at home. Remember to start slowly, listen to your body, and breathe deeply throughout the movements.
